CARTA presents Anthropogeny: The Perspective from Africa - Sarah Wurz: Klasies River as a 120000-Year-Old Archive of Human Behavior in South Africa


Listen Later

This CARTA symposium focuses on the contributions of scientists and scholars of anthropogeny who live and work in Africa. Sarah Wurz, University of the Witwatersrand, discusses the Klasies River site which was a favored home base for southern Cape humans between 120,000 and 2300 years ago.
